Output b57428009e3e6552188b421df52c338237de8439f3bfe8770592fbbe4ff7d14e:0

value
647753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984a964e82a8851cd099ba14a6769ab89c02c190 OP_EQUAL
address
3FaFz7ADQqvDcuyLpm9d4x7Vgfi19qYuHw
transaction
b57428009e3e6552188b421df52c338237de8439f3bfe8770592fbbe4ff7d14e
spent
true